Carbon Steel Tank Maintenance: Best Practices
Regular care of a carbon steel tank is vital for guaranteeing its lifespan and avoiding costly breakdowns . A proactive approach, involving periodic examinations , is necessary. This is a few key best guidelines:
- Thoroughly examine the outside of the tank for indications of rust , damage , and seepage .
- Perform inside inspections whenever feasible , typically using dedicated equipment.
- Establish a detailed cleaning routine to discard sediment and reduce corrosion.
- Apply protective linings as needed according to a suggestions .
- Keep complete records of all upkeep activities .
By sticking to these basic suggestions , you can significantly extend the duration of a carbon steel container and decrease the chance of unforeseen issues .

Guidelines and Requirements for Carbon Steel Tank Construction
The building of steel tanks is rigorously governed by a intricate web of codes and standards to ensure safety and prevent contamination. Key organizations include the American Petroleum , the American Welding Society of Mechanical Engineering , and various regional regulatory authorities . These guidelines address everything from material selection and welding procedures to material degradation mitigation and verification protocols. Adherence is typically verified through certified inspection and certification .
- Carbon specification based on usage .
- Welding procedures and approvals for welders .
- Structural analysis to withstand pressure .
- Testing protocols to find defects .
- Coating applications to prevent corrosion .
Lack of adherence these regulations can result in serious repercussions, including spills, system breakdown , and legal penalties .
